CEC Eleminated In Tight 4-3 Tennis Match

Oct 8, 2012

Kerry Rodd-NSO


Cloquet-Esko-Carlton was eliminated from Section tennis play on Monday after a 4-3 loss to Hibbing/Chisholm in Hibbing. The Jacks lost three-of-four singles matches en-route to the defeat. A coin flip with Big Lake at the section meetings sent the Jacks to Hibbing rather than to face rival Hermantown in the first round of Sub-Sections

The lone victory for CEC in singles play was by Rosalie Lundquist who defeated Kayla Marschalk 6-1, 6-4 at #4 singles. At #1 singles Rachael Collier fell to Mikaela Krampotich 6-0, 6-1 and at #2 it was Lora Chalich dropping a 6-1, 6-1 decision to H/C’s Christina Matetich by a 6-1, 6-1 score. Katelyn Litke of CEC fell to Emily Milani 6-0, 6-1 at #3 singles.

The Jacks rebounded in doubles play to take two-of-three matches including a victory at #1 doubles by Reilly Kedrowski and Alyssa Acheson who defeated Miranda Morris and Janell Shea 6-3, 4-6, 11-9. Breanne Baker and Katrina Smith took a win for CEC at #2 doubles when they beat Madelion Pusatero and Emily Warner 2-6, 7-5, 6-3. The Jacks lost at #3 doubles when Abby Wangen and Courtney Ketola dropped a 7-5, 6-2 match to Raini Haybloom and Megan Hodge.
